Ragnell was a female sergeant who served as an engineer and mechanic aboard the New Republic's Lodestar. At one point, Imperial defector Yrica Quell asked Ragnell to paint her new squadron's starfighters with the Alphabet Squadron insignia.[2]
Personality and traits
Ragnell was heavily tattooed with colorful whorls, dancing figures, and other elaborate pictograms. Sometimes, she would work in the hangar at night, noting to General Hera Syndulla that her body was still stuck on Chandrilan time.[2]
